Aurdonius Ažubalis (Minister of Foreign Affairs)
MINISTRY OF FOREIGN AFFAIRS (www.urm.lt)
Born on 17 January 1958 in Vilnius
1976 graduated from Vilnius Antanas Vienuolis secondary school
1976–1977 studied journalism at Vilnius State University, Faculty of History, but was expelled from the university for relations with Lithuanian Helsinki Group members
1977–1979 served in the Soviet Army
1982 was permitted to continue journalism studies at Vilnius State University
1989 received a degree in journalism
1990 studied politics and economics at World Press Institute, Macalester College, St. Paul, Minnesota, USA
1979–1988 worked at the Lithuanian State Committee on Publishing Houses, Polygraph Enterprises and Book Trade, Lithuanian Scientific Methodological Culture Centre, Lithuanian State Committee for Television and Radio Broadcasting, Lithuanian State Cinema Rent Bureau
1989–1990 Reporter of the Atgimimas, a Lithuanian Reform Movement Sąjūdis weekly newspaper
1990–1992 Spokesman for the Chairman of the Supreme Council (Reconstituent Seimas)
1991–1993 Head of the Information and Analysis Centre of the Office of the Supreme Council (Reconstituent Seimas)
1993–1996 Founder and head of the first public relations consultancy in Lithuania
1996–2000 Member of the 7th Seimas. Chairman of the Committee on Foreign Affairs.
2001–2004 Director General of the Translation and Information Centre under the Chancellery of the Government of the Republic of Lithuania
2004–2008 Member of the 9th Seimas, Member of the Committee on Foreign Affairs
From 17 November 2008 Member of the 10th Seimas, Chairman of the Committee on Foreign Affairs
29 January 2010 By Presidential Decree, appointed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Fifteenth Government
